What Makes a Small Refrigerator the Best Choice for You?
The best small refrigerator for you will depend on various factors tailored to your needs and lifestyle.
- Size and Capacity: Choosing the right size is crucial as it determines how much food and beverages you can store. Small refrigerators typically range from 1.7 to 5.5 cubic feet, making them suitable for limited spaces like dorm rooms or small apartments.
- Energy Efficiency: An energy-efficient model can save you money on electricity bills and reduce your carbon footprint. Look for units with the ENERGY STAR label, which indicates they meet strict efficiency guidelines and can help you save on energy costs over time.
- Design and Layout: The design should fit your aesthetic preferences and practical needs. Consider features like adjustable shelves, door bins, and separate compartments for better organization and accessibility of your items.
- Cooling Technology: Different models use various cooling technologies, such as compressor-based or thermoelectric cooling. Compressor models tend to be more effective at maintaining consistent temperatures, while thermoelectric options are quieter and more energy-efficient for smaller loads.
- Noise Level: If you have a small living space, the noise level of the refrigerator can be a significant factor. Look for models that advertise quiet operation or have sound ratings, especially if you plan to place it in a bedroom or shared living area.
- Price and Warranty: Budget is always a consideration when purchasing a refrigerator. Compare prices and features, and consider the warranty offered; a good warranty can provide peace of mind and protection for your investment.
- Additional Features: Some small refrigerators come with extra features like built-in freezers, reversible doors, or adjustable temperature settings. These additional functionalities can enhance usability and convenience, depending on your specific requirements.

What Is the Difference Between Mini Fridges and Compact Refrigerators?
| Aspect | Mini Fridge | Compact Refrigerator |
|---|---|---|
| Size | Generally smaller, designed for tight spaces like dorm rooms or offices. | Larger than mini fridges, suitable for small apartments or as secondary units. |
| Capacity | Typically holds around 1.5 to 3 cubic feet. | Usually offers 4 to 10 cubic feet of space. |
| Power Consumption | Lower energy usage, making them cost-effective for small storage. | Higher energy consumption due to greater capacity and features. |
| Price | More affordable, usually ranging from $100 to $250. | Priced higher, typically between $200 and $600 depending on features. |
| Weight | Lightweight, often between 30 to 50 pounds. | Heavier, typically ranging from 50 to 100 pounds. |
| Cooling Technology | Uses thermoelectric or basic compressor systems. | Generally equipped with more advanced compressor cooling technology. |
| Features | Basic features; may include a small freezer compartment and limited shelving. | More features; often includes adjustable shelves, multiple compartments, and larger freezer sections. |
| Typical Brands/Models | Popular brands include Black+Decker, Haier, and Danby. | Common brands include Whirlpool, GE, and Frigidaire. |
